From Osher Doctorow
Xiaolei Zhang's "On the nature of quantum phenomena," arXiv: 0712.4297
v1 [quant-ph] 28 Dec 2007, 42 pages, is a "tour de force" of Zhang's
theory of quantized phenomena as a scenario of phase transitions that
are successive and basically non-equilibrium.
Zhang adopts a non-Probabilistic viewpoint and even claims more or
less that Probability isn't Fundamental in his theory, but his theory
agrees with the conclusions and/or hypotheses/conjectures of Probable
Causation/Influence (PI) that:
1) Phase Transitions are Fundamental to the Universe
2) Superluminal motion is not only allowed but does and/or did occur
in the Universe at a Fundamental level.
In fact, according to Zhang the lowest hierarchy of phase transitions
occurs in a "resonant cavity" formed by all the matter and energy
content of the Universe and quantum processes there are superluminal,
while finite 'universal' speed of light (c) restrictions apply to
(some) higher levels of the hierarchy.
Zhang doesn't discuss PI in his paper, and he is careful to leave many
doors open to what has already been discovered and in many places what
is commonly agreed upon in quantum theory (more than PI does).
